Job Summary
Manages clinical operations and clinical staff at assigned patient care facility, collaborating with clinicians in the evaluation and analysis of patient needs for prosthetic and/or orthotic services.
Meets with physicians, case managers and other referral sources to review services and capabilities, and develops and enhances business relationships to identify and secure ongoing and future sources of referrals.
